Stalking tools have become increasingly prevalent in today's digital age, raising significant concerns about privacy and security. These tools can be used for a variety of purposes, ranging from legitimate tracking of lost devices to more sinister applications, such as invading someone's personal space without their knowledge. Understanding the implications and functionalities of stalking tools is crucial for anyone concerned about their privacy.
Here are some key points to consider regarding stalking tools:
- Types of Tools: Common stalking tools include GPS trackers, mobile spyware, and social media monitoring apps.
- Legal Implications: The use of stalking tools without consent is illegal in many jurisdictions and can lead to severe penalties.
- Privacy Risks: Users should be aware of the risks associated with these tools, including potential data breaches and unauthorized access to personal information.
- Protective Measures: It's essential to take steps to protect oneself from being tracked, such as using privacy settings and being cautious about sharing personal information online.
- Awareness and Education: Staying informed about the latest stalking tools and their capabilities can help individuals safeguard their privacy.
